You are only 3 weeks post op and still healing. My doctor only recommend walking for the first 6 weeks. Check with your doc before you do any exercise besides walking. I am 8 weeks post op today. On Sunday, I was finally able to walk 2 miles at a brisk pace without passing out. We can do it.

I agree- you may be doing too much too soon. I would stick to walking for another couple weeks. You could call your doc.s office and see what they reccomend.
